Transaction 95568be42375e2f031c4ecdccab11f8b426b8131f77aa3ce8a605b2d7daa88ea
1 Input
1 Output
-
95568be42375e2f031c4ecdccab11f8b426b8131f77aa3ce8a605b2d7daa88ea:0
- value
- 21224
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5d5ded2bb724c7958cd4c9769ef3af9fae934d60004d50f8c008b5a79faf808e
- address
- bc1pt4w762ahynretrx5e9mfaua0n7hfxntqqpx4p7xqpz6608a0sz8q8h54k4